Output 402716c1869d5e0e63d8d6eb497dfa95aa22d0f63a2dee0dc54dd958873da607:3

value
1405632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71dce05e748de1216b30332d5a5b7758f08885d6 OP_EQUALVERIFY OP_CHECKSIG
address
1BP3xSac4epECfU9zVBwhpxQZQEdoeFqpr
transaction
402716c1869d5e0e63d8d6eb497dfa95aa22d0f63a2dee0dc54dd958873da607
confirmations
226398
spent
true